Meme Generation

Generate actual meme images from a topic. Picks a template, writes captions, and renders a real .png file with text overlay.

When to Use

  • User asks you to make or generate a meme
  • User wants a meme about a specific topic, situation, or frustration
  • User says "meme this" or similar

Available Templates

The script supports any of the ~100 popular imgflip templates by name or ID, plus 10 curated templates with hand-tuned text positioning.

Curated Templates (custom text placement)

ID Name Fields Best for
this-is-fine This is Fine top, bottom chaos, denial
drake Drake Hotline Bling reject, approve rejecting/preferring
distracted-boyfriend Distracted Boyfriend distraction, current, person temptation, shifting priorities
two-buttons Two Buttons left, right, person impossible choice
expanding-brain Expanding Brain 4 levels escalating irony
change-my-mind Change My Mind statement hot takes
woman-yelling-at-cat Woman Yelling at Cat woman, cat arguments
one-does-not-simply One Does Not Simply top, bottom deceptively hard things
grus-plan Gru's Plan step1-3, realization plans that backfire
batman-slapping-robin Batman Slapping Robin robin, batman shutting down bad ideas

Dynamic Templates (from imgflip API)

Any template not in the curated list can be used by name or imgflip ID. These get smart default text positioning (top/bottom for 2-field, evenly spaced for 3+). Search with:

Procedure

Mode 1: Classic Template (default)

  1. Read the user's topic and identify the core dynamic (chaos, dilemma, preference, irony, etc.)
  2. Pick the template that best matches. Use the "Best for" column, or search with --search.
  3. Write short captions for each field (8-12 words max per field, shorter is better).
  4. Find the skill's script directory:
    SKILL_DIR=$(dirname "$(find ~/.hermes/skills -path '*/meme-generation/SKILL.md' 2>/dev/null | head -1)")
    
  5. Run the generator:
    bash
    python "$SKILL_DIR/scripts/generate_meme.py" <template_id> /tmp/meme.png "caption 1" "caption 2" ...
    
  6. Return the image with MEDIA:/tmp/meme.png

Mode 2: Custom AI Image (when image_generate is available)

Use this when no classic template fits, or when the user wants something original.

  1. Write the captions first.
  2. Use image_generate to create a scene that matches the meme concept. Do NOT include any text in the image prompt — text will be added by the script. Describe only the visual scene.
  3. Find the generated image path from the image_generate result URL. Download it to a local path if needed.
  4. Run the script with --image to overlay text, choosing a mode:
    • Overlay (text directly on image, white with black outline):
      bash
      python "$SKILL_DIR/scripts/generate_meme.py" --image /path/to/scene.png /tmp/meme.png "top text" "bottom text"
      
    • Bars (black bars above/below with white text — cleaner, always readable):
      bash
      python "$SKILL_DIR/scripts/generate_meme.py" --image /path/to/scene.png --bars /tmp/meme.png "top text" "bottom text"
      
    Use --bars when the image is busy/detailed and text would be hard to read on top of it.
  5. Verify with vision (if vision_analyze is available): Check the result looks good:
    vision_analyze(image_url="/tmp/meme.png", question="Is the text legible and well-positioned? Does the meme work visually?")
    
    If the vision model flags issues (text hard to read, bad placement, etc.), try the other mode (switch between overlay and bars) or regenerate the scene.
  6. Return the image with MEDIA:/tmp/meme.png

Pitfalls

  • Keep captions SHORT. Memes with long text look terrible.
  • Match the number of text arguments to the template's field count.
  • Pick the template that fits the joke structure, not just the topic.
  • Do not generate hateful, abusive, or personally targeted content.
  • The script caches template images in scripts/.cache/ after first download.

Verification

The output is correct if:

  • A .png file was created at the output path
  • Text is legible (white with black outline) on the template
  • The joke lands — caption matches the template's intended structure
  • File can be delivered via MEDIA: path
